This can be caused by the UPNP Multicast group used by Chromecast not being permitted by default.
Resolution
Enable multicast group 239.255.255.250 on the wireless controller from the Web GUI with the following process:
Click Controller > Network > Topologies
Click the Topology Chromecast is connected to
Click Multicast filters tab
Click Multicast Bridging check box
Click IP group Radio button and add 239.255.255.250/32
Click Save
